Wood is one of the oldest building materials. For hundreds of years, the harvesting, supply and trading of wood has created industry and economic opportunity. Throughout history, the sustainability of the wood supply has also presented challenges. This seminar will examine the evolution of sustainable harvesting, forest management and the legal supply...
